I disagree. This thread needs to be posted to as often as possible. Here is why: probably around 90% of people who stumbled upon BiblePay did so by finding this thread on this forum. The other 10% are masternode sites, airdrop, etc. Rob has also directed traffic to the BBP forum a lot of times and most of the time it's completely legitimate, when there is a need for some really in-depth discussion or a proposal thread etc. And I am all for that, for the BBP forum to have more posts as well, it's good for community buildup and so on.

But I think we should never steer away from this thread, because this is how people find BiblePay. Think about it, someone new can't possibly go to forum.biblepay.org as their first touch with BiblePay. It's for people already in the game who know the link, have an account etc. (While I'm at it, I think accounts should not have to be manually verified by the admin, just put a recaptcha and it's fine). This thread is how we stand out from others, I follow a lot of threads and much higher market cap coins don't have nearly as much posts as we do, therefore we gain free exposure this way, and it shows how active of a community we are.

So I think we should not move just about any discussion to the "invisible" forum, or else what would happen is that only the old members would be active on the BBP forum, this thread would be less active and therefore less findable, which would lead to lowering the member count, as some old members would slowly leave over time and not enough new ones would come. The BBP forum should definitely be more content rich than this thread, but it's sort of a level 2 for newcomers, to discover and dig through after they could find us in the first place.

What does everyone think about the usability of BiblePay so far in the real world? And also the upcoming possible changes?

Which changes are we looking at, the roadmap goals?


https://wiki.biblepay.org/Roadmap

Mobile Phone Wallet   
MIPs iPhone and Android Wallet (Both iPhone and Android are complete - Android deployed to Prod - iPhone waiting for Apple to approve deployment)
November 30th, 2018         
90%
---
Marketing Campaigns   Phase 2
(Proposal for PR Campaign, Language Translations)    
March 31st, 2019    
3%
---
BiblePay IPFS Integration and feature set    
BiblePay adds the ability to store IPFS documents, business objects, and provide a decentralized DNS system for accessing file resources.    
March 31st, 2019    
5%
---
BiblePay Evolution (Dash) Rebase    
BiblePay merges and releases all of the Evolution codebase - and re-launches as BiblePay Evolution with a PR campaign and with a BANG!    June 30th, 2019    
5%
---
Market Biblepay as a Utility   
BiblePay is working on an IPFS revenue stream derived from leasing fees generated by storing documents in IPFS hosted with BiblePay.
This cements BiblePay as a Utility.
December 25th, 2019    
0%
---
Biblepay Debit Card   
Partnership with VISA/MasterCard/or Generic Branded Debit Card    
December 25th, 2019    
1%
---
E-Commerce Integration   
Integration with Retailers accepting Biblepay plug-in    
December 25th, 2020    
25%

The idea is starting with a modest proof-of-concept by compiling biblepayd and biblepay-cli with the rebased code. If we can make a working devnet/testnet with that, the GUI part will be just pure legwork (a very long one in any case).

I already rebased 40% of the files for the command line version, but Rob and I are cautious because testing will probably take longer that rebasing itself. Well it could also work fine at the first attempt, who knows, I prefer to be optimistic.

In any case it will take some weeks more to have better visibility.

1) Regarding the BOINC Team blacklist feature in BiblePay PODC: I was only stating my initial opinion - that to give PODC more credibility we ensure a feature exists that does not allow double dipping (it was part of the Sanc vote for removing the team requirement); However I want to explain:  I am not in disagreement with doing whatever the community wants.  If we feel the UTXO requirement is already enough, If the community votes to have the blacklist removed - then lets remove it.  Action Item:  I will add a new community poll on forum.biblepay.org ASAP for this.

2) Regarding multiple forums:  I want to apologize for the miscommunication - I am not unhappy with the way TheSnat or TMike are moderating this forum.  I was only making a point that I never originally intended to censor information - unless it violated community guidelines- and I agree fullheartedly that this forum should be reserved for positive constructive General discussion and we need to keep it clean and entirely without infighting.  Lets all grow up and act more mature and make BiblePay into a professional cryptocurrency where people feel warm and welcome when making initial contact.  They may read 10 pages and decide not to be part unless they already feel warm and fuzzy.  

I believe it is essential to have forum.biblepay.org available for organization.  This threads purpose (BTCTalk) is for Attracting users off the street - those people who browse bitcointalk and discover us.  This is our on-ramp thread.  Forum.biblepay.org is for focused discussion on each area.  Moderation is still needed to ensure that we maintain a professional presence.

3) Regarding the Dash Rebase (Dash Evolution):  MIP is spearheading this project.  He is in the process of analyzing every diff between Dash and BiblePay.  We plan on carving out a regular IT meeting together to create the full scope of the rebase (that includes any new features we try to create for our next release) into a mid 2019 Evolution release.  We really need a PR volunteer to help us create a PR campaign around this future rebase as this event is similar in magnitude to a BiblePay re-launch.
